
Research article “Programmable Coherent Linear Quantum Operations with High-Dimensional Optical Spatial Modes” has been published online on Physical Review Applied
In this work, we proposed and demonstrate a simple and flexible scheme to perform arbitrary linear quantum operations with high fidelity and high dimensionality. SIC POVMs and QFT are performed with a dimensionality of 15 × 15. Since DCS modes are used, we believe that our work will have potential to fully explore SPDC in high-dimensional quantum applications, including switching of Bell states, and is also compatible with operating path-encoded qudits. The corresponding work has been published online on Physical Review Applied (https://link.aps.org/doi/10.1103/ PhysRevApplied.14.024027) on August 12. Shikang Li is the first author. Professor Xue Feng is the corresponding author.
